The Foundation of Reliability: Core Service Intervals
For any vehicle, a consistent service history is key. For a used Subaru Crosstrek, adhering to a regular schedule is even more critical as it may have a history you’re not fully aware of. Here’s a look at what the service schedule for a used Subaru Crosstrek typically involves.
The most fundamental of all maintenance tasks is the Subaru Crosstrek oil change. Clean oil is the lifeblood of the robust BOXER® engine, ensuring all its moving parts are properly lubricated and cooled. So, how many miles is ideal between Subaru Crosstrek oil changes? The general consensus and manufacturer recommendation is every 6,000 miles or 6 months, whichever comes first. This interval ensures that your engine is protected from premature wear and tear. During this service, it’s also standard practice to replace the oil filter and perform a tire rotation to ensure even tread wear, which is especially important for an all-wheel-drive vehicle.

Building on the Basics: The Crosstrek Maintenance Schedule Unpacked
As the miles accumulate, your Crosstrek will require more comprehensive checks. These are the most common service intervals for a Crosstrek that you should be aware of:
The 6,000-Mile (or 6-Month) Check-in: This is your basic, yet crucial, service stop. As mentioned, it includes a Subaru Crosstrek oil change and tire rotation. A technician will also perform a multi-point inspection, checking fluid levels, and visually inspecting the brakes.
The 12,000-Mile (or 12-Month) Inspection: Building on the 6,000-mile service, this interval includes a more thorough Crosstrek brake service inspection. The brake pads and rotors will be examined for wear, and the brake lines and parking brake system will be checked. The cabin air filter is also typically replaced at this point to ensure the air you’re breathing inside the vehicle is clean.
The 30,000-Mile (or 30-Month) Major Service: This is a significant milestone in your Crosstrek maintenance schedule. In addition to the standard oil change and tire rotation, this service often includes replacing the engine air filter and brake fluid. The cooling system, fuel lines, and drive belts will also be thoroughly inspected. For models with a manual transmission, the clutch and transmission fluid may also be inspected.
The 60,000-Mile (or 60-Month) Tune-Up: This comprehensive service is a key part of your Crosstrek tune-up guide. It typically includes replacing the spark plugs, which are vital for fuel efficiency and engine performance. Depending on the model year and previous service history, the transmission fluid may be replaced. A detailed inspection of the wheel bearings and suspension components is also performed.

Special Considerations for Used Crosstrek Upkeep
When you own a used vehicle, it’s wise to be proactive. Beyond the standard Subaru service intervals, keep an eye out for common issues that can arise in Crosstreks, such as oil consumption or C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ission) behavior.
